    The Bible teaches that true strength comes from humility and grace, not from defeating others. Rivalry can blind you to your own potential, focusing your energy on competition rather than growth. When you lift others up, you elevate yourself, creating a path to mutual success. By seeking unity over division, you build a stronger community and a more peaceful heart.

    Philippians 2:2-3

    2 Fulfil ye my joy, that ye be likeminded, having the same love, being of one accord, of one mind.3 Let nothing be done through strife or vainglory; but in lowliness of mind let each esteem other better than themselves.”

    Galatians 5:19-21

    19 Now the works of the flesh are manifest, which are these; Adultery, fornication, uncleanness, lasciviousness,20 Idolatry, witchcraft, hatred, variance, emulations, wrath, strife, seditions, heresies,21 Envyings, murders, drunkenness, revellings, and such like: of the which I tell you before, as I have also told you in time past, that they which do such things shall not inherit the kingdom of God.”

    Mark 9:34

    34 But they held their peace: for by the way they had disputed among themselves, who should be the greatest.”

    James 4:6

    6 But he giveth more grace. Wherefore he saith, God resisteth the proud, but giveth grace unto the humble.”

    1 John 4:12

    12 No man hath seen God at any time. If we love one another, God dwelleth in us, and his love is perfected in us.”
